Screw Conveyor Example | Engineering Guide

The capacity (CP) given in the example is 25,600 lbs. per hour. Please note: Do not use Selection Capacity (SC) to calculate horsepower. The screw conveyor length is 16-feet. The Material Factor (MF) or HP Factor for corn meal is 0.5 from the Bulk Material Table. Nomenclature: ... Trough: TUA1212 angle flange trough with 12-gauge trough thickness

Inclined Screw Conveyors

At certain angles of incline and screw pitch values, a portion of the helical flight is virtually on the horizontal plane; this reduces the forward action of the flight, resulting in loss of …
